Johnny Hekker
 

For a few minutes Sunday, Rams punter Johnny Hekker was the baddest man in football. After booming a punt away in Seattle, he laid a hit on Seahawks defensive end Cliff Avril.


Seattle would get its revenge. When Hekker punted later in the game, Avril and teammate Michael Bennett frightened Hekker without taking a penalty.

After the game, Bennett called Hekker "a little girl."


Earlier in the week, Hekker was named to his second Pro Bowl. He also earned a bid in 2013 when he performed a similar cheap shot act against the Saints that December:

Unfortunately for the Seahawks, the bad guys won yesterday. With nothing to play for but pride and respect, the Rams won their third straight (and second this season against Seattle), 23-17.

Despite the loss, the Seahawks clinched a playoff berth.
